CHINAVTM MINING (00893.HK): Expects H1 Turnaround to Loss of No More Than RMB 10 Million
NewTimeSpace News: On 18 August 2026, China Vanadium Titano-Magnetite Mining Company Limited (stock code: 00893) issued a profit guidance, expecting a net loss attributable to owners of the Company of no more than approximately RMB 10.0 million for the first half of 2026, versus a net profit of approximately RMB 1.0 million in the prior-year period.
The announcement attributed the expected loss mainly to the continued suspension of mining operations to advance the upgrade and expansion of the Maoling-Yanglongshan iron mine, which significantly reduced the production and sales of high-grade iron concentrate; lower trading volumes due to high inventories and weak demand in the steel-consuming industry; and reduced guarantee fee income from a former subsidiary as overall guarantee risks declined substantially. The facilities management segment maintained stable recurring revenue during the period. The interim results announcement is expected to be published by the end of August 2026.
